Summary

The purpose of this study is to determine if patients with melancholic bipolar II depression are more responsive to lamotrigine than patients with non-melancholic bipolar II depression. To do this, the investigators will re-analyze a previous clinical trial that evaluated lamotrigine as a treatment for bipolar II depression (GSK-SCA100223; NCT00274677).
